🌶️ Texas Roadhouse-Style Chili
Ingredients:
2 lbs ground beef (or chuck)
1 small onion, finely chopped
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 (14.5 oz) can diced tomatoes, with juice
1 (8 oz) can tomato sauce
1 (15 oz) can kidney beans, drained and rinsed
1 cup water (or beef broth for more flavor)
2 tbsp chili powder
1 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p smoked paprika
1/4 tsp cayenne pepper (optional for heat)
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1 tbsp brown sugar (optional for balance)
Optional Toppings:
Shredded cheddar cheese
Diced red onions
Jalapeño slices
Sour cream
Crushed crackers or cornbread
---
Instructions:
1. Brown the meat:
In a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at, cook ground beef until browned. Drain excess fat.
2. Add aromatics:
Stir in onions and garlic. Cook 3–4 minutes until softened.
3. Build the flavor:
Add diced tomatoes, tomato sauce, beans, and water (or broth). Stir well.
4. Season the pot:
Mix in chili powder, cumin, paprika, cayenne, salt, pepper, and brown sugar.
5. Simmer low and slow:
Cover partially and simmer on low heat for 45 minutes to 1 hour, stirring occasionally. Add a splash more water if it gets too thick.
6. Taste and adjust:
Add salt or more spice if needed. Simmer another 10 minutes for richer flavor.
7. Serve hot:
Ladle into bowls and top with your favorites!
